The History And Origins Of Monterey Jack And Cheddar Cheese

Monterey Jack cheese has roots dating back to the 18th century in Monterey, California. Originally made by Franciscan friars to preserve surplus cow’s milk, this semi-hard cheese gained popularity for its smooth texture and mild flavor. It wasn’t until entrepreneur David Jacks began selling the cheese in the late 1800s that it became widely known as Monterey Jack.

Cheddar cheese, on the other hand, hails from the English village of Cheddar in the 12th century and is one of the world’s most popular cheeses today. Known for its rich, sharp taste and crumbly texture, Cheddar cheese was traditionally aged in the cool, damp caves of the Cheddar Gorge. Over time, the cheese-making process evolved, leading to the creamy, tangy Cheddar cheese we enjoy today.

Both Monterey Jack and Cheddar cheese have rich histories steeped in tradition and innovation, making them versatile and beloved cheeses in various culinary applications worldwide.

Pairing Perfection: Wine And Beer With Monterey Jack And Cheddar

When it comes to pairing Monterey Jack and Cheddar cheese, the right beverage can elevate the experience to a whole new level. Both cheeses have versatile flavor profiles that can be complemented by a selection of wines and beers. For Monterey Jack, opt for a crisp white wine like Sauvignon Blanc or a light-bodied red such as Pinot Noir. These wines work well with the mild and tangy notes of Monterey Jack, enhancing its creamy texture.

Cheddar cheese, with its rich and sharp taste, pairs wonderfully with a variety of beers. A classic choice is a hoppy IPA which can stand up to the bold flavor of Cheddar. If you prefer a sweeter note, try a fruity cider or a malty brown ale. These beverages can balance the intensity of Cheddar, creating a harmonious taste experience. Tips For Proper Storage And Cheese Care

Properly storing Monterey Jack and Cheddar cheese is crucial to maintain their freshness and flavor. To ensure your cheeses stay in optimal condition, wrap them tightly in wax paper or parchment paper before sealing them in a plastic bag or airtight container. This will protect the cheeses from absorbing odors in the refrigerator while allowing them to breathe.

Store your cheeses in the warmest part of the refrigerator, typically the vegetable drawer, to prevent them from getting too cold and becoming crumbly. It is important to keep Monterey Jack and Cheddar cheese separate from other strong-smelling foods to avoid flavor contamination. Allow the cheeses to come to room temperature before serving to enhance their flavors and textures. What Is Monterey Jack Cheese And What Sets It Apart From Other Cheeses?

Monterey Jack cheese is a semi-hard, cow’s milk cheese that originated in the United States. It has a smooth texture and a mild, slightly tangy flavor. What sets Monterey Jack apart from other cheeses is its versatility. It melts easily, making it a popular choice for dishes such as quesadillas, nachos, and grilled cheese sandwiches. It also comes in variations like pepper Jack, which includes spicy peppers for an added kick. Overall, Monterey Jack cheese is known for its creamy texture, mild taste, and adaptability in a wide range of dishes.
